Saturday, March 23, 2013

Eden, Texas

The claim: 1500 bed privately run federal center. Currently holds illegal aliens.

What it really is: While everything is factually true (and it probably does hold illegal aliens there that have committed crimes), what is not mentioned is that the prison is a low-security prison.

